    Content: From “Psychiatric Problems at the Buddhist Priest’s Hospital in Thailand” to “Political Dimensions of Psychiatric Thought,” Transcultural Research in Mental Health emphasizes the international and interdisciplinary facets of mental health. From fieldwork to philosophy the approach is as diverse, exciting, and far-reaching as the actual problems and orientations of cross cultural research in this area.
